How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Etna Green?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Etna Green Studio Apartments | $1,054 | $575 | $1,685 |
Etna Green 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,198 | $750 | $2,790 |
Etna Green 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,484 | $905 | $3,140 |
Etna Green 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,653 | $1,050 | $3,495 |
Etna Green 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,408 | $1,408 | $1,408 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Etna Green
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Etna Green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Etna Green ranges from $750 to $2,790 with an average monthly rent of $1,198.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Etna Green c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Etna Green range from $905 to $3,140.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,484.
How expensive are Etna Green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 19 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Etna Green on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,050 to $3,495 - averaging $1,653 for the location.
